How to Choose Your Wedding Shoes
Avoid a common mistake brides make: Don’t forget about your wedding shoes!
Sure, your wedding dress will take center stage at your nuptials, but your wedding shoes are just as important on your big day. The shoes complete your special bridal ensemble and make you feel fabulous all day long – that is, if you chose the perfect pair.

It’s important to take extra time and consideration when you choose shoes for your wedding. The old adage that "no one will see my shoes" is completely false!
Not only will your bridal shoes be on display throughout your wedding, but you’ll likely want to show them off.
When you choose shoes for your wedding, consider the following details:
- Shop early!
You don’t want to wait until the last minute to purchase bridal shoes. Why? Because your dress needs to be hemmed to accommodate your heels. Once you’ve found the dress of your dreams, start shopping for your shoes so you have them in time for your first fitting. - Think About Your Location.
Any time you get dressed, you consider where you’re going before you pick out your shoes – you wear gym shoes to go hiking, flip flops to the pool, heels for a night on the town – and when you choose shoes for your wedding, it’s no different.
If you have a beach wedding, you probably don’t want towering stilettos – they’ll make it impossible to walk in the sand.
Saying "I do" outside in a garden? Wedges will be easy to walk in on grass and gravel. Consider your wedding’s venue. - What's Your Wedding Style?
It would look silly to wear cowboy boots in a fancy ballroom, but that shoe choice might be perfect for the barn wedding of your dreams.
Consider your wedding’s theme and vibe when choosing your bridal shoes. Is it fancy, laid-back, vintage, country, colorful, traditional?
You want everything at your wedding to look cohesive and that applies to your shoes, too. - Complete Your Look.
It’s not all about the dress – your wedding day outfit is a complete ensemble, from head to toe. Make sure your shoes coordinate and effortlessly compliment your gown, veil, jewelry and bouquet.
This may mean matching the metal finishes throughout, paying attention to ivory vs. white, or making sure the materials mesh together.
A soft white tulle gown with bright patent leather or snakeskin shoes Mismatch!
Wearing bright gold shoes with a dress that only has silver beading? Distracting mismatch! - Comfort.
Above all, you need to be comfortable. This is the most important day of your life – do you want to be distracted by your aching feet? You’ll be wearing these shoes from your ceremony to your photos to your reception to the dance floor – all day and night until you and your new husband make your excited exit as newlyweds. That’s hours upon hours in that pair of shoes – so invest in a good pair!
Be realistic about your history with heels. Are you the woman who can’t dance in heels? Do you feel uneasy in anything but a flat?
Don’t use your wedding day as testing grounds for your stiletto skills. With today’s bountiful selection of bridal shoes, you don’t have to sacrifice style for comfort!
